عنوان انگلیسی مقاله ISI
A validation methodology and application of 3D garment simulation software to determine the distribution of air layers in garments during walking

چکیده انگلیسی
The methods to determine air gap thickness and contact area are limited for stationary position of the manikin. In this study, 3D garment simulation software was quantitatively validated by comparing these parameters obtained from this tool with the ones obtained from accurate 3D scanning method to assess the capability of 3D garment simulation software. Moreover, for the first time, these parameters were calculated for garments on walking male avatar wearing t-shirt and sweatpants. The agreement between two methods were within a range of 23â¯mm and 65%, and 10â¯mm and 45% for the air gap thickness and contact area of upper and lower body garments, respectively. Furthermore, the adapted post-processing method could discriminate the differences in the observed parameters over the body regions and among the phases of the movement. The introduced post-processing method can be used to improve 3D garment software for the determination of the regional parameters.
